Description
A delicious twist on the classic grilled cheese, combining juicy beef patties and melty cheese for the ultimate comfort food experience.
Ingredients
- 1 pound 85% lean ground beef
- 3 tablespoons chopped fresh flat-leaf parsley
- 1 tablespoon finely chopped garlic
- 1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
- 1 teaspoon Montreal-style steak seasoning
- 2 tablespoons butter
- 6 slices white bread
- 6 slices Colby-Jack cheese
Instructions
- In a bowl, thoroughly combine the ground beef, parsley, garlic, Worcestershire sauce, and steak seasoning.
- Form the mixture into three equal patties.
- Heat a nonstick griddle and place the patties on it.
- Cook the burgers to your desired doneness, aiming for 4 to 6 minutes on each side.
- Remove the burgers from the heat and set aside.
- On a separate griddle, warm it over medium heat.
- Butter one side of each slice of bread.
- Lay half of the bread slices on the griddle, buttered-side down.
- On each slice, add a slice of cheese, place a burger, and another slice of cheese.
- Top with the remaining bread slices, buttered-side up.
- Cook until the bread is golden brown and the cheese melts, about 6 to 10 minutes, flipping halfway through.
Notes
For added flavor, consider adding sliced onions or mushrooms. Ensure cheese is at room temperature before cooking.
